> > > Previously, our XFS fuzzing efforts were limited to using the xfs_db
> > > blocktrash command to scribble garbage all over a block.  This is
> > > pretty easy to discover; it would be far more interesting if we could
> > > fuzz individual fields looking for unhandled corner cases.  Since we
> > > now have an online scrub tool, use it to check for our targeted
> > > corruptions prior to the usual steps of writing to the FS, taking it
> > > offline, repairing, and re-checking.
> > > 
> > > These tests use the new xfs_db 'fuzz' command to test corner case
> > > handling of every field.  The 'print' command tells us which fields
> > > are available, and the fuzz command can write zeroes or ones to the
> > > field; set the high, middle, or low bit; add or subtract numbers; or
> > > randomize the field.  We loop through all fields and all fuzz verbs to
> > > see if we can trip up the kernel.
